Claims (5)

  1. Glazing block (10e, f) for glued-in glazing, comprising a glass side (14), which points to the glass (12) in the usage state, and a frame side (18) which points to the frame rebate (16), wherein a plurality of cavities (20e, f) for receiving adhesives are arranged on the frame side (18), wherein the material portions defining the cavities (20e, f) are spring devices (22e, 22f), characterised in that the spring devices (22e, 22f) consist of mutually spaced apart pipes (22e) or hollow cylinder casing portion-shaped shells (22f).
  2. Glazing block (10e, f) as claimed in claim 1, characterised in that the part of the glazing block which in the usage state points to the frame rebate (16) and contacts same is adapted to the shape of the frame rebate (16).
  3. Glazing block (10, f) as claimed in claim 1 or 2, characterised in that it consists of synthetic material.
  4. Glazing block arrangement comprising a first and a second glazing block (10e, f) as claimed in any one of claims 1 to 3, characterised in that the first glazing block (10e, f) comprises a connecting web (34) which is connected to the second connecting block (10e, f) such that the respective longitudinal axes of the connecting blocks (10e, f) extend transversely with respect to one another.
  5. Glazing block arrangement as claimed in claim 4, characterised in that the longitudinal axes extend at right angles with respect to one another.
